Ardea melanocephala compared with Rallus crepitans

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Черношейная цапля Восточный пастушок-трескун
Kingdom same Animalia (животные) Animalia (животные)
Phylum same Chordata (хордовые) Chordata (хордовые)
Class same Aves (птицы) Aves (птицы)
Order Pelecaniformes (пеликанообразные) Gruiformes (Журавлеобразные)
Family Ardeidae Rallidae
Genus Ardea Rallus
Species Ardea melanocephala Rallus crepitans

Evolutionary Relationship

Черношейная цапля and Восточный пастушок-трескун share a common ancestor at the Class level: Aves. (птицы)
